Nel panorama attuale del gioco online, offrire un’esperienza utente fluida e coinvolgente su dispositivi mobili rappresenta una priorità. Per aziende come Aviator Spribe, leader nel settore delle scommesse e dei giochi di casual gaming, trovare il giusto equilibrio tra velocità di caricamento e qualità visiva è fondamentale per mantenere l’interesse dei giocatori e favorire la crescita del business.
Indice dei contenuti
- Analisi delle principali sfide tecniche nel bilanciare rapidità e prestazioni su dispositivi mobili
- Metodologie di sviluppo per migliorare l’efficienza senza compromettere la qualità del design
- Strategie di ottimizzazione dell’esperienza utente per aumentare velocità e qualità
- Valutazione dell’impatto delle soluzioni adottate sui risultati aziendali
Analisi delle principali sfide tecniche nel bilanciare rapidità e prestazioni su dispositivi mobili
Limitazioni hardware e impatto sulla progettazione dell’interfaccia utente
I dispositivi mobili presentano una gamma vasta di hardware, dai più economici ai top di gamma. La limitata potenza di elaborazione e memoria di molti dispositivi comporta sfide cruciali nella progettazione dell’interfaccia utente. Ad esempio, giochi con grafica complessa e animazioni fluide necessitano di ottimizzazioni specializzate per garantire che anche i dispositivi meno performanti possano offrire un’esperienza soddisfacente. Uno studio condotto da Google nel 2021 evidenzia che il 53% degli utenti abbandona un sito mobile che impiega più di tre secondi per caricarsi. Conseguentemente, l’ottimizzazione del design deve considerare il limite di hardware, semplificando elementi grafici e riducendo le risorse richieste senza compromettere l’engagement.
Gestione delle risorse di rete per minimizzare i tempi di caricamento
La qualità della connessione di rete varia considerevolmente tra utenti, con molte regioni che continuano a sperimentare banda limitata o instabile. Questo influisce direttamente sui tempi di caricamento di Aviator Spribe, che può richiedere l’elaborazione di dati complessi o contenuti multimediali pesanti. Per affrontare questa sfida, è essenziale implementare strategie come la compressione dei dati, l’uso di CDN (Content Delivery Network) e il caricamento asincrono di risorse. Ad esempio, ridurre la dimensione delle immagini del 30-50% senza perdita evidente di qualità può ridurre significativamente i tempi di caricamento, migliorando l’esperienza utente e riducendo il rischio di abbandono.
Bilanciare la complessità grafica con la fluidità dell’applicazione
Un elemento chiave nella sfida tra velocità e qualità consiste nel trovare il giusto equilibrio tra effetti visivi avanzati e performance. Ad esempio, l’integrazione di animazioni dettagliate può arricchire l’esperienza, ma può anche rallentare l’app se non ottimizzate correttamente. Un approccio efficace è adottare tecniche come il lazy loading, il rendering vettoriale (SVG) e l’utilizzo di grafica vettoriale compatibile con più dispositivi. L’esempio di giochi che impiegano animazioni leggere e transizioni fluide, mantenendo il caricamento rapido, evidenzia come la semplificazione intelligente possa migliorare sia la qualità visiva sia la reattività.
Metodologie di sviluppo per migliorare l’efficienza senza compromettere il design
Utilizzo di framework ottimizzati per il mobile e tecniche di code splitting
Una soluzione efficace consiste nell’impiegare framework come React Native o Flutter, che permettono di sviluppare app performanti ottimizzate per mobile. Inoltre, tecniche di code splitting consentono di suddividere il codice in moduli caricabili su richiesta, riducendo i tempi di caricamento iniziali. Ad esempio, un’app che scarica solo le funzionalità strettamente necessarie all’avvio, caricando altre risorse successivamente, si mostra più reattiva. Un’analisi di casi di successo mostra che un’applicazione divisa in moduli può ridurre fino al 40% i tempi di caricamento complessivi, migliorando l’esperienza di gioco.
Implementazione di progressive enhancement per diverse capacità hardware
Il principio del progressive enhancement consiste nel adattare l’app alle capacità hardware del dispositivo dell’utente. Per esempio, su dispositivi più vecchi o meno potenti, si può limitare l’uso di effetti grafici complessi, privilegiando un’interfaccia più semplice e reattiva. In dispositivi di fascia alta, invece, vengono attivate animazioni avanzate e elementi grafici di qualità superiore. Questo approccio permette di offrire un’esperienza ottimale a tutti, ottimizzando le risorse e mantenendo un livello di qualità elevato ovunque. Per approfondire le opportunità offerte da queste strategie e scoprire eventuali promozioni, puoi consultare il Corgibet codice promo.
Test di performance continui durante lo sviluppo e l’implementazione
Per garantire che le ottimizzazioni siano efficaci, è fondamentale integrare test di performance regolari nel ciclo di sviluppo. Utilizzare strumenti come Lighthouse di Google o WebPageTest permette di monitorare metriche come il tempo di caricamento, la reattività dell’interfaccia e l’efficienza delle risorse utilizzate. L’adozione di una mentalità di miglioramento continuo aiuta a identificare e risolvere rapidamente eventuali criticità, assicurando che l’esperienza rimanga fluida e coinvolgente.
Strategie di ottimizzazione dell’esperienza utente per aumentare velocità e qualità
Design intuitivo e navigazione semplificata per ridurre i tempi di interazione
Un design minimale e funzionale permette agli utenti di accedere rapidamente alle funzionalità principali. Menù semplici, pulsanti grandi e una gerarchia chiara delle informazioni riducono il tempo di decisione e interazione. Ad esempio, nei giochi come Aviator Spribe, la visualizzazione immediata dei dati di gioco e un’interfaccia senza elementi superflui migliorano la percezione di reattività dell’app.
Personalizzazione dinamica in base alle caratteristiche del dispositivo
Adattare dinamicamente l’interfaccia alle capacità hardware consente di ottimizzare l’esperienza. Questo può includere la regolazione di dettagli grafici, la riduzione di effetti visivi o l’attivazione di modalità di risparmio energetico su dispositivi meno recenti. La personalizzazione aiuta a mantenere l’esperienza fluida, minimizzando i tempi di caricamento e massimizzando la soddisfazione dell’utente.
Integrazione di feedback visivi per migliorare percezione di reattività
Feedback visivi come animazioni di caricamento, indicatori di progresso e risposte istantanee a ogni azione migliorano la percezione di una piattaforma reattiva. Questi elementi non accelerano i tempi di caricamento, ma influenzano positivamente la percezione del ritmo e della fluidità dell’app, contribuendo a mantenere alto il coinvolgimento dell’utente.
Valutazione dell’impatto delle soluzioni adottate sui risultati aziendali
Analisi di metriche di caricamento e interazione utente
Monitorare le metriche di caricamento, come il tempo medio di caricamento delle pagine e il tasso di abbandono, permette di valutare l’efficacia delle ottimizzazioni implementate. Dati raccolti tramite strumenti analitici consentono di identificare punti critici e misurare miglioramenti nel tempo.
Misurazione della soddisfazione degli utenti e feedback raccolti
Questionari, recensioni e feedback diretti forniscono insight qualitativi sulla percezione dell’esperienza di gioco. Risultati positivi e l’aumento delle recensioni a 5 stelle indicano che le strategie di bilanciamento tra velocità e qualità hanno un impatto diretto sulla soddisfazione dei giocatori.
Impatto sulla retention e sulla crescita dei giocatori
Un’esperienza mobile ottimizzata si traduce in una maggiore retention degli utenti e in un aumento del numero di nuovi giocatori. L’analisi dei dati di retention e dei tassi di crescita consente di correlare le ottimizzazioni tecniche alle performance commerciali.
« L’ottimizzazione delle prestazioni su mobile richiede un equilibrio continuo tra risorse, design e capacità dell’utente. Solo così si può offrire un’esperienza coinvolgente senza sacrificare la fluidità. »
